6. How Topography Influences the Fate of Human Neural Progenitor Cells
University essay from Lunds universitet/Tillämpad biokemi; Lunds universitet/BeräkningskemiAbstract : Novel biomimetic three-dimensional scaffolds have emerged over the last decades, and are promising for applications in regenerative therapies, as well as in in vitro disease modelling and drug testing. Thanks to their added dimension, these scaffolds are able to more accurately mimic the topography of native cellular microenvironments compared to traditionally used two-dimensional culture substrates. 10. Τοwards a Synthetic Tryptophan Aminotransferase
University essay from Linnéuniversitetet/Institutionen för kemi och biomedicin (KOB)Abstract : The synthesis and evaluation of a molecularly imprinted polymer has been undertaken using an oxazine-based tryptophanamide transition state analogue (TSA) as template. An efficient route to the synthesis of oxazine-based TSAs for the reaction of pyridoxamine and indole-3-pyruvic acid has been established, with yields of up to 80%. READ MORE
